Chreze:


Thing is I have not done any withdrawal. I am just testing it while I am waiting for my Monzo card to be delivered. I selected cash as my withdraw option. To withdraw, after I change currency to GBP, I noticed that the available balance is showing zero when I selected GBP unlike when you select naira and it will show the naira available and you select the amount you want to withdraw.

Please can you explained how you did yours. The process used. Thanks man
Alright
Under fiat market, select GBP

Sell btc for GBP

Head to withdrawal, select fiat u will then see your available currencies for withdrawal( in this case u will see naira and GBP)

Select GBP and setup your receiving account details. END

If i understood you, u thought your available naira will be converted to pounds, I don't think so. It's treated like a coin on binance
Since there is no GBP/NGN ticker, u hv to trade your naira for any assets under the GBP market like btc and and sell the assets for GBP, then withdraw the GBP to your British Bank account

I hope this is helpful

Phenmeson:


Going into a rented apartment with kids, is advisable you get a semi furnished apartment. You buy your own Mattress, freezer, sofa, kettle, microwave e.t.c. If any property belonging to the Landlord is damaged, you must pay for it even after you moved out. Mind you, most UK private apartments will want you to vacate the house like the way you met it. I once lived in 1bedroom flat unfurnished,when moving out, the van Removal staff damaged the stair handrail, when doing check out by my Landlord, I lost all deposit of over £1000 because my Landlord wants me to repair the stair handrail, paint the house the way I moved in and do so some other stuff.
Thank you for the heads up
